how do you adjust the idle speed for the 6.2 diesel and to what rpm?

project 6.2L
10-24-2004, 03:47 PM
I would set it at 650-700 RPM for idle if you go too much lower then that the engine won't have sufficient oil pressure and the load up a little more with soot and carbon.


To adjust the idle, on the driver side of the injection pump there is a flat blade screw with a spring on the throttle shaft assembly, turn cockwise to incease and visa-versa.

Texas Diesel Guy
10-24-2004, 05:25 PM
While your setting your L.I. you should check the fast idle solenoid to make sure its not interfering and that when its energized idle speed goes to about 800. flat blade screw driver works for this too, just push it in to see how fast it will idle with it energized.
